1
resposta

Tabela criada corretamente mas no servidor errado

Prezados,

Apesar de a tabela ter sido criada corretamente, ela não foi criada no 'dbserver.Databases.alura_receita', e sim no servidor que veio junto a instalação do Postgree. Neste caso, após as migrações, apareceram tanto a database (alura_receita) quanto as tabelas dentro de 'PostgreSQL10.Databases.alura_receita'.

Como eu poderia corrigir esse erro para que a tabela atualizada fosse a do servidor correto?

Desde já, agradeço.

1 resposta

Olá Rafael, tudo bem com você?

Peço desculpas pela demora em obter um retorno.

Este é um comportamento esperado, uma vez que os novos servidores estão apontando para um mesmo local - geralmente localhost e que possuem a mesma porta 5432. Para que isso não ocorra, é necessário se conectar a outro hostname e outra porta.

Entretanto, vale informar que os database são criados contendo regras que definem quais usuários poderão realizar sua manipulação, assim, por mais que um usuário possa visualizar que o banco existe, caso este usuário não tenha acesso liberado ao database, ele não poderá realizar sua manipulação. Na Alura temos uma formação de PostgreSQL que aborda sobre otimização, manutenção de um ambiente seguro com o gerenciamento de acessos, usuários, permissões no PostgreSQL, caso queira conhecer, basta acessar o link apresentado abaixo:

Espero ter ajudado. Continue mergulhando em conhecimento!

Abraços e bons estudos!

Caso este post tenha lhe ajudado, por favor, marcar como solucionado ✓. Bons Estudos!